From 062ff7508984278682b39e094c855ce2d658d115 Mon Sep 17 00:00:00 2001 From: Stephen Seo Date: Sat, 16 Jun 2018 19:55:08 +0900 Subject: [PATCH] Add SFML as a dependency --- CMakeLists.txt |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index 8fdc328..64245c8 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-27,9 +27,13 @@ endif() target_compile_features(MeterForPulseAudio PUBLIC cxx_std_14) +find_package(SFML 2 REQUIRED COMPONENTS graphics window system) +target_include_directories(MeterForPulseAudio PUBLIC ${SFML_INCLUDE_DIR}) +target_link_libraries(MeterForPulseAudio PUBLIC + sfml-graphics sfml-window sfml-system) + find_package(PulseAudio 11 REQUIRED) message(STATUS "Found PulseAudio ${PulseAudio_VERSION}") - target_include_directories(MeterForPulseAudio PUBLIC ${PULSEAUDIO_INCLUDE_DIR}) target_link_libraries(MeterForPulseAudio PUBLIC ${PULSEAUDIO_LIBRARY}) -- 2.49.0